What strikes you immediately upon seeing this ring is the gorgeous spiderweb turquoise cabochon. The turquoise is light to medium blue with black matrix and there are some areas of blue that are transitioning to green through wear and contact with hand oils. It is secured with a wonderful serrated bezel, which is a seldom-seen detail on these early rings. Flanking the stone are silver spheres (raindrops), three on either side. Below the raindrops are stamped details, including an eagle or bird figure. While it is a small size, this ring would be a good candidate for a resize by your local jeweler. The band has a blank space at the bottom available to open up so you would not lose any stamped details. Or, simply wear it as a pinky ring.
